I think that is the point of the law. Universities here operate under something called the CanCopy agreement, which makes provisions like the one in the original query. In reading that agreement, it seemed clear to me that (2) was intended, becuase universities are in the special position where the material is used for either teaching or research.

I've just Googled for CanCopy and of course, it's been changed since I last read it, and the 1-chapter-or-10% rule has been altered to just 10%, period. There are slightly different rules for textbooks (5% or 1 chapter, whichever is less). But I maintain that the previous version of CanCopy was consistent with (2) above.
